How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Dakota?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Dakota Studio Apartments | $958 | $452 | $1,345 |
Dakota 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,186 | $474 | $2,229 |
Dakota 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,432 | $571 | $2,349 |
Dakota 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,582 | $665 | $2,575 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Dakota
How much are Studio apartments in Dakota?
There are currently 14 Studio Apartments in Dakota with rent ranges from $452 to $1,345 with an average price of $958.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Dakota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Dakota ranges from $474 to $2,229 with an average monthly rent of $1,186.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Dakota c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Dakota range from $571 to $2,349.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,432.
How expensive are Dakota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 14 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Dakota on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$665 to $2,575 - averaging $1,582 for the location.
